The Breakdown – Cowboys Comeback or Eagles Collapse?
The Cowboys found themselves down and out at 21-0 behind against the reigning championship champions, so how on earth did they produce their equal-largest comeback ever?
Sentiment of a initial home game after a teammate’s untimely death could have played a part, however it was a combination of Dak Prescott determination and a defence that cashed in on rare errors by the Eagles.
Dak surpassed Romo’s marks for passing yards (now thirty-four thousand three hundred seventy-eight) and game-winning drives (twenty-five) with an dynamic performance – his plunging touchdown embodying his energetic display.
Philly wasted a lead of twenty-one points or more for the first time since nineteen ninety-nine, with only their second game with several giveaways this year – the previous being a bad NFC East loss at the Giants.
In addition to fourteen infractions for ninety-six yards, the attacking struggles that affected Hurts after what – for him – was an fast start was significant. He had only thrown for 200-plus yards in 4 games before Sunday, he had more than one hundred fifty in the opening two quarters alone in Texas.
However from the time the Eagles went 21-0 up their offence fell apart dramatically – with four straight kicks, a failed field goal and then a turnover handing opportunity after opportunity to the Dallas.
Philadelphia’s defence is brilliant, it truly is, but an offense that's not surpassed 21 points in five of seven games (3 losses) is now a huge concern, as the components are all there but it's simply not working.
Sirianni’s game is all about securing the key situations, the defence keeps them in it and what offense there is manages barely enough – if it can't even do that and now the discipline and possession security is breaking down, there may be trouble ahead.
In Focus – Playoff Patrick Shows Up Prematurely to Save Kansas City
It wasn’t quite as dramatic, but the Chiefs’ eleven-point recovery in the final period against a strong Colts squad was very impressive – and may have just rescued their season.
How big was it? Indeed, the league’s advanced analytics now give the Chiefs a fifty-eight percent chance of reaching the playoffs, when a defeat on the weekend would have reduced that figure to 28%.
No wonder the postseason version of Patrick Mahomes arrived, throwing for 235 yards in the latter half by itself and leading 3 scoring drives in their last 4 possessions to win it in extra time.
Some huge passes and daring runs are commonplace for Patrick in the playoffs, but currently the Kansas City are in playoff form – at six and five and just tenth in the AFC standings.
This was more like the former Chiefs though, with a first close victory of the year after losing five already – they secured 11 of them the previous season so, if that confidence returns, this Chiefs Kingdom may not be finished so soon.
Discussion – Can Bears Be Rulers of the North?
You can no longer overlook the Chicago Bears now. A win over the Pittsburgh Steelers, minus Aaron Rodgers, kept them top of the NFC North and at 8-3 – sharing the same record as the Eagles.
They look dangerous on each side of the ball, with a defense that leads the league in picks and total takeaways and, in Caleb Williams, a young quarterback now used to winning tight games.
He can at times be shaky, surrendering a score after a fumble in his own end zone – but he additionally passed for 3 scores and, with already five fourth-quarter comebacks this season, he knows how to get the job done.
Green Bay are in close chase in the division after overpowering the Vikings and Detroit are right there after overcoming the New York in overtime with a monster game from Gibbs.
Chicago are interestingly the most reliable with 8 victories in nine, but as they travel to the championship winners on the holiday we'll discover just how good they really are.

Will Shedeur Sanders Retain His Starting Role?
Browns head coach Kevin Stefanski batted away inquiries on whether Sanders had performed sufficiently in his first professional outing to maintain the first-team position when Dillon Gabriel returns.
Yet the question will keep being raised as Shedeur became the first Browns quarterback to secure his first NFL game after Zeier in 1999 – with seventeen additional first-year quarterbacks failing to do so afterward.
It came just the Las Vegas, and with the help of an almost aggressive Cleveland defence getting 10 sacks, but the Browns’ offense requires a director, a presence to inspire confidence.
